Sec. 3849.157. AD VALOREM TAX. (a) If authorized at an election held in accordance with Section 3849.162, the district may impose an annual ad valorem tax on taxable property in the district for any district purpose, including to:
(1) maintain and operate the district;
(2) construct or acquire improvements; or
(3) provide a service.
(b) The board shall determine the tax rate. The rate may not exceed the rate approved at the election.
Added by Acts 2007, 80th Leg., R.S., Ch. 949 (H.B. 4004), Sec. 1, eff. June 15, 2007.
